Reporting to the Procurement & Logistics officer, the position is responsible for coordinating and initiating purchase orders and procurement of goods and services for the company and conducting research to determine procurement of goods and services at competitive prices.
Main Duties and Responsibilities:
- Implements procurement plans by initiating purchase orders for submission to prospective suppliers.
- To manage the operation of an Inventory System to effectively control stocks and avoid overstocking, stock-outs, and always ensure correct usage.
- Plan and coordinate the replenishment of inventory to ensure smooth operations for all departments in the company.
- Carry out spot checks to verify the accuracy of stock records and ensure that inventories are secure and safe to prevent losses/damages.
- Design and review stores record-keeping system for the efficient management of stock.
- Review and recommend identified redundant and obsolete stock for disposal.
- Prepare and produce periodic reports on the operations of the company’s section for management’s decision-making.
- Contribute to the development and review of Stores Procedures Manual to ensure compliance and efficiency of store management.
- Assist in the preparation of annual budget and procurement planning for all stock items to meet annual operational requirements.
- Monitors procurement progress on all planned activities.
- Tracks vendors and suppliers to ensure timely delivery of goods and services.
- Maintains and updates suppliers’ register.
- Reviews purchase requisitions for completeness and accuracy and follow up on discrepancies with the initiating department.
- Collects quotations and prepares comparative analysis.
- Maintains procurement files and records.
- Prepares and processes standard procurement documents.
- Performs any other duties as assigned by the Supervisor.
